* To install, you need 5-6 GB of free space and a stable Internet.
* Since this works on termux and on software rendering, the performance is clearly dependent on the read/write speed, CPU, RAM, and storage.
* Don't try heavy apps if you don't have a good device.

**🔊 Audio**

* Audio works by turning on the pulse server with tcp receiver module at 127.0.0.1 and the udroid manager will take care of starting the audio service (some applications require additional configuration).

### **🌆 Graphics**

* There is currently no standardized way to access or fully utilize a GPU device, so llvm channels are used! (OpenGL version may vary depending on device OS). Most of the solutions are vendor specific performance or implementation gimmicks (such as kernel graphics / DRI support).
* The best way to experience the performance of native Linux is to use the Termux-X11 app, which is an Android port.

### **🛠️ Other**

* PRoot for Android is still under development and not ready for everyday Linux use. all Linux codes and applications are not intended for PRoot. popular apps like Snap Flatpack that depend on Systemd (which is impossible without root and the Hallium project on Android) will not work. Proot on the Android platform is being developed primarily through the efforts of termux and many casual developers, as well as a significant portion of the Linux / Android user community. This project is also the result of a lot of experimentation and a combination of tricks and gimmicks to get anything up and running on Android.
